No. A tariff is something paid to import a product or service, this is a fine for breaking laws. If I visited the US, rented a car, drove it down a freeway at 120 mph, I'd likely get fined. If I make a car and sell it and the buyer happens to be in the US, that buyer would have to pay the tariff. |
